Pinecrest Academy was not able to break out of their rough patch on Monday as the team picked up their third straight defeat. Their tough 13-3 loss to the Scholars Guild Academy Spartans might stick with them for a while.
Pinecrest Academy got a big performance out of Chris Calupca, who scored a run and stole two bases while getting on base in two of his three plate appearances. The team also got some help courtesy of Joseph Frain, who scored a run while going 2-for-3.
On Scholars Guild Academy's side, Eli McIlvain and Alton Strange made a big impact no matter where they played. On the mound, McIlvain struck out eight batters over 3.2 innings while giving up just one earned (and one unearned) run off five hits. Meanwhile, Strange tossed two inn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it (he also didn't allow any walks). At the plate, McIlvain scored two runs while going 1-for-3, while Strange scored a run and stole two bases while going 2-for-4. Strange has been hot recently, having posted at least one stolen base the last five times he's played.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Ty Newton, who went 2-for-3 with a home run, three additional RBI, and two additional runs.
Pinecrest Academy's defeat dropped their record down to 2-4. As for Scholars Guild Academy, they have been performing well recently as they've won four of their last five matches, which provided a massive bump to their 5-6 record this season.
Pinecrest Academy will play host again on Tuesday to welcome Cherokee Christian, where first pitch is scheduled at 4:30 p.m. Cherokee Christian is coming into the game with three straight losses on the road, meaning Pinecrest Academy will have to defend against a team hungry for a win.
